We are pleased to announce that USAID has awarded JSI the Comprehensive Technical Assistance for Health Supply Chain and Pharmaceutical Management (Comprehensive TA) IDIQ award, a mechanism within the Next Generation Global Health Supply Chain Suite of Programs (NextGen).

In achieving this milestone opportunity, we are proud to support USAID’s 10-year goal of ensuring sustainable access to and appropriate use of safe, quality-assured, affordable health commodities through locally-led supply chain and pharmaceutical management systems.

JSI’s portfolio of over 40 supply chain projects is characterized by local leadership engagement and our deep understanding of clients, context, and drivers of access to health products.
